Execute python em um script php usando shell_exec ()
Eu estou tendo um problema estranho em tentar executar o python em um servidor php (LAMP). (safe_mode desativado)
se eu digitar:
$output = shell_exec("ls -lah");
echo "<pre>$Output</pre>";
Eu tenho o resultado dols
comando. O mesmo para$output = shell_exec("tar --version");
e outros aplicativos, como o gzip.
No entanto, se eu mudar para qualquer uma destas linhas:
$output = shell_exec("python --version");
$output = shell_exec("python2.7 --version");
$output = shell_exec("/usr/bin/python --version");
$output = shell_exec("python my_script.py");
E outras variantes deste tipo, não obtenho resultados. O comando não está sendo executado, o bitecode do Python não foi feito eoecho
permanece em silêncio.
Eu também tentei com oexec()
comando sem mais sucesso.